AFBC- Atmosphearic fluidized bed combustion boiler.

CFBC Circulating fuidized bed combustion boiler.


The initial cost of AFBC boiler is much lower than CFBC boiler, so it is preferred at low capacity. For higher capacity CFBC is more efficient so lower operating cost, so it is preferred. CFBC operation and maintenance is more sophisticated.
